Transaction 5e304939a90e56adf572b8d4c3cb67ad78f734b4fdb5e8922b58dee83d435c48

1 Input
2 Outputs
  • 5e304939a90e56adf572b8d4c3cb67ad78f734b4fdb5e8922b58dee83d435c48:0
  • value  8377500
    address  3CpmPDqgLiWSBduh8FsubHQdQP67NS1dUn
  • 5e304939a90e56adf572b8d4c3cb67ad78f734b4fdb5e8922b58dee83d435c48:1
  • value  22827160
    address  19MPJwRCB96A4u1t7DfYaDmApD58WLwrrJ